Pattern filters
Generate procedural backgrounds and textures from Effects → Patterns. Choose from stripes, squares, dots, honeycomb, grid, rays, zigzag, geometric layouts, retro fifties tiles, and procedurally generated mazes. Tune cell counts, multi-color palettes, angles, and style presets; preserve transparency to blend patterns over photos. Ideal for wallpapers, social backgrounds, and retro design.

Frequently asked questions
What do pattern filters do?
They turn a source photo into repeated graphic texture or pattern.
Can I use a pattern behind type?
Yes. Generate the pattern, then place a headline or cutout on top.
Will the repeat tile seamlessly?
Results vary. Review the repeat before you use it as a fill.
Can I combine a pattern with color effects?
Yes. Stack the pattern look with other editor effects in the same project.
